The Texas Longhorns may very well be the most confounding team in college football today.

Steve Sarkisian’s crew is all over the place this season, The Longhorns fell to Florida, then defeated Oklahoma, and needed overtime to beat Kentucky behind a truly terrible offensive effort, 16-13. Fans from around the country came together to flame Steve Sarkisian for his team’s woeful offensive effort.

It’s hard to blame them. The Wildcats are one of the worst teams in the SEC, and Texas was only able to put up 171 yards across 4 quarters of football. Arch Manning had another tough day for Texas, too. The former 5-star QB completed 12 of his 26 passing attempts for 132 yards and no touchdowns.

The Longhorns couldn’t get any sort of run game going, either. Texas averaged a brutal 1.6 yards per carry and finished the game with a grand total of 44 yards rushing.
